From: martini-bounces@ietf.org [mailto:martini-bounces@ietf.org] On Behalf Of Bernard Aboba Sent: Sunday, October 10, 2010 9:11 PM To: martini@ietf.org Subject: [martini] Consensus call on Public GRUU language There is one outstanding issue on the GIN document, which relates to SSP support for public GRUUs. We would now like to have a consensus call of the WG on this point. The consensus call will last until October 17, 2010. Please respond to this email indicating whether you wish to change the current text in the document, and if so, how. Choices include: (1) No change (public GRUU support remains optional). (2) Change the MAY to: "The SSP SHOULD support the public GRUU mechanism described in this section." (3) Change the MAY to: "The SSP MUST support the public GRUU mechanism described in this section, unless the SSP has other means of providing globally routable contact URIs."
